Private or dealer or wreckers- Who pays you top cash for cars?

The private sale of the used car offers the seller some advantages: you can determine the price and conditions himself. However, you also need a little patience for the sale on your own, because depending on the price segment of the car, it may take a little while for a buyer to be found. In order to get a buyer, the path usually leads via a listing – either on the Internet in used car exchanges or in the newspaper.

If you like, you can also advertise your car in themed internet forums or groups on social media. Here you will often find lovers who appreciate a particular model. A note in the car alerts passers-by. A viewing and test drive appointment will then be arranged with serious interested parties – preferably with a trusted companion. A contract may be drawn up beforehand, which stipulates that the test driver is liable for damages and pays for any excess and downgrade in the motor insurance scheme. Have your driver’s license shown in advance. If there is agreement, it is important to record the private car sale in writing in a sales contract. Corresponding templates are available on the Internet

Attention: Make sure that legal warranty is excluded.

Selling Car to dealers or wreckers:

If the car is to be sold quickly, buying it from a dealer is the best choice. Although the price of the purchase is usually less than the amount that could be achieved at the private sale, the facts are quickly on the table, the seller does not have to deal with many enquiries or test drives.

This is best suited for end-of-life cars or completely damaged cars. Not only dealers and wreckers pay top cash for cars, they also buys them irrespective of the car condition. The process is completely paperless and you will be paid during the pickup.
